Objectives
Contents
- Development of global energy consumption, correlation with population growth, correlation with carbon dioxide emissions growth
- Development and world wide energy mix
- Development of German energy consumption; comparison to other countries
- Energy System Germany
- Meaningness of thermal energy in comparison to electric energy, especially for heating and process energy.
- Energy usage chains
- Basics of Energy Policy
- Lwas and Regulations
- Dynamic calculations of enonomic performance
- electricity exchange
- emissions and emission trading
Acquired Skills
- analysis of building energy balances
- preparation of energ audits
